Dr. Estes received his Ph.D. from the University of Chicago and joined the faculty of Chapman University in 1985. He is founding member of Chapman University's London Summer Program that offers a range of courses that bring students to one of the most exciting cities in the world, including Dr. Estes's course in Historical London. Dr. Estes regularly teaches courses in British History and Film, Modern British History, Western Civilization, the Middle Ages, Modern Europe, and Western Intellectual Thought. In the spring, 2005, Dr. Estes provided the mentorship that enabled two history majors to present the findings of their senior seminar papers at a professional historical conference. |
